
[jump] The Jacka began as a member of Mob Figaz, the Pittsburg rap group led by C-Bo and founded in 1997. Beginning in 2001, he independently released a prolific spate of mixtapes and collaborative albums. They featured a hardboiled and cagey persona, yet cut with distinct streaks of empathy, regional pride, and, in later years, deeply considered reflection on family and faith. His local collaborators included E-40, Andre Nickatina, and Mac Dre.
At the end of 2014, the Express listed Highway Robbery, his collaboration with Freeway, among the year’s finest local releases.
